Páginas filhas
  • 7430848 DVAFIN-4290 DT Arquivo entrando em loop na leitura da Redecard


01. DADOS GERAIS

Linha de Produto:Virtual Age
Segmento:Moda
Módulo:Financeiro
Função:FCRFP169 - Baixa de Cartão por Extrato Eletrônico
Ticket:7430848
Requisito/Story/Issue (informe o requisito relacionado) :DVAFIN-4290


02. SITUAÇÃO/REQUISITO

No momento da leitura de um arquivo da operadora Redecard, o sistema abre a janela de carregamento e não finalizada, deixando o procedimento de leitura de arquivo de extrato eletrônico travada. Isto porque a operadora Redecard estava enviando uma nova informação particular da operadora que não estava tratada dentro do sistema, o que ocasionava um loop na leitura do arquivo, travando o processo. 

03. SOLUÇÃO

Foi efetuado o tratamento para leitura destes arquivos, para interpretação correta do arquivo e efetivação da leitura.


Imagem - Na imagem acima, como podemos observar ao tentar efetuar a leitura do arquivo da Rede o sistema quando chegava no 100 por cento, ficou travado carregando.

Imagem 2 - Na imagem como podemos observar, realizamos um teste depois de gravado os registros, alterando o numero do registro na entidade de cartão, e como o sistema não conseguiu encontrar o registro, ao invés de entrar em LOOP ele mostrou a mensagem de RO não encontrado.

Imagem 3 - Na imagem acima, cadastramos o registro para leitura e conciliação, e ao tentar efetuar a leitura do arquivo novamente, veja que agora o arquivo foi lido com sucesso.

Imagem 4 - Na imagem acima, vemos que foi gerado o registro de 85,00 enviado pela operadora, referente a uma venda.

Imagem 5 - Na imagem acima, depois da leitura do arquivo, vemos que foi enviado neste arquivo um ajuste no valor de 85,00, relacionado a venda anterior.